Paquetes de gel: A Reliable Alternative for Temperature Control

Gel packs are one of the most commonly used alternatives to dry ice. These cooling packs are filled with a gel that retains cold for extended periods. They are widely used in industries like food and pharmaceuticals due to their versatility and ease of use.

Cómo funcionan

Gel packs absorb heat from the contents of the package, maintaining the desired temperature range for extended periods. They typically keep temperatures between 32°F and 60°F, which is perfect for refrigerated goods.

Materiales de cambio de fase (PCM): Precision Temperature Control

Materiales de cambio de fase (PCM) are gaining popularity due to their ability to maintain specific temperatures for extended periods. These materials absorb or release heat as they change between solid and liquid states.

Cómo funcionan

PCMs are designed to melt and freeze at a specific temperature. Por ejemplo, a PCM that melts at 4°C can maintain that temperature for hours, ensuring that temperature-sensitive products remain within the desired range.
